4. For each Community, starting at the top line with thefirst quadrat sampled, build a species-area curve. A species-area curve looks at the number ofdifferent species encountered (y-axis) and area sampled (# of quadrats,x-axis). Continue to plot this way foreach coordinate (so, with each coordinate you sample, add to your graph) untilit starts to even off like the example.
